Wizards: Tales of Arcadia (or simply Wizards) is an upcoming Netflix original animated series created by Guillermo Del Toro, produced by DreamWorks Animation and Double Dare You. It is the third and final installment in the Tales of Arcadia franchise, succeeding Trollhunters and 3Below.

Part One will be released in 2020.[1]

Premise

Following Trollhunters and 3Below, DreamWorks Wizards brings together the three disparate worlds of trolls, aliens, and wizards who have found themselves drawn to Arcadia. The final chapter of the Tales of Arcadia culminates in an apocalyptic battle for the control of magic that will ultimately determine the fate of these supernatural worlds that have now converged.[2]

Trivia

  • Wizards was originally announced to be released by the end of 2019. However, Guillermo Del Toro confirmed on his Twitter account[3] that the release has been delayed to 2020.
    • The reason for the delay could likely be because Del Toro is currently shooting a new thriller movie called "Nightmare Alley"[4] (which has no official release date, but speculated to be released somewhere in 2020).
